Canonical biassociative groupoids [PDF]
In the paper Free biassociative groupoids, the variety of biassociative groupoids (i.e., groupoids satisfying the condition: every subgroupoid generated by at most two elements is a subsemigroup) is considered and free objects are constructed using a chain of partial biassociative groupoids that satisfy certain properties.

Assembly of constructible factorization algebras
Abstract We provide a toolbox of extension, gluing, and assembly techniques for factorization algebras. Using these tools, we fill various gaps in the literature on factorization algebras on stratified manifolds, the main one being that constructible factorization algebras form a sheaf of symmetric monoidal ∞$\infty$‐categories.

On the local Kan structure and differentiation of simplicial manifolds
Abstract We prove that arbitrary simplicial manifolds satisfy Kan conditions in a suitable local sense. This allows us to expand a technique for differentiating higher Lie groupoids worked out in [8] to the setting of general simplicial manifolds. Consequently, we derive a method to differentiate simplicial manifolds into higher Lie algebroids.

Cancellative Elements in Finite AG-groupoids
An Abel-Grassmann's groupoid (briey AG-groupoid) is a groupoid Ssatisfying the left invertive law: (xy)z = (zy)x for all x, y, z \in S. In the present paper, wediscuss the left and right cancellative property of elements of the nite AG-groupoidS.
